The Animal Crossing Clock is a DSiWare application. As with the Animal Crossing Calculator, it costs 200 Nintendo Points, or $1.99 on the Nintendo eShop.

Features

  • Analog and digital clock with 12 and 24 hour display
  • Town Tune editor
  • Alarm

References to the Animal Crossing games

  • The first alarm sound is the same as the sound that plays when the player catches a fish or a bug in Animal Crossing: City Folk and Animal Crossing: Wild World.
  • The second alarm sound is the same as the sound that plays when Resetti appears in front of the player in the Animal Crossing games.
  • The third alarm sound is the same sound that plays at 1 PM in Animal Crossing: Wild World and Animal Crossing: City Folk
  • When the time reaches the top of the hour, the application plays the Town Tune that the player has assigned.
  • Four Animal Crossing characters are seen besides the clock on the top screen (8 with the digital clock). These characters change every five minutes.
